The Rick Owens Fall/Winter 2012 Range is a Vision of the Future

In the new Rick Owens Fall/Winter 2012 collection, the designer takes a postmodern, minimalist approach to his new diverse range of monochromatics. Slender silhouettes of leather, fur, velvet and cotton materials make up a striking collection of futuristic black and gray garments.

Jumpsuits, long trench coats and high-waisted pants exaggerate the model's proportions, giving wearers an even more elongated look, while only a few looser-fitting pieces are present in the designer’s latest showing. Signature details Owens is known for, like shirts with draping elements and structural, box-like tailoring, are revisited but different enough from his previous offerings.
